About converting US Cup to Cubic Meter

Converting US Cup to Cubic Meter is a common volume conversion. One us cup (cup) equals 0.000236588 cubic meter (m³). Cups are the most common volume measurement in American home cooking and baking.

Did you know?

The US cup (240 mL) isn't a formally defined SI or imperial unit — it varies slightly from Commonwealth and Japanese 'cup' measurements, a common source of recipe conversion errors.

Did you know?

A cubic meter of water weighs almost exactly 1,000 kilograms (1 metric ton) at standard conditions, a handy rule of thumb in engineering and construction.

How many us cup are in 1 cubic meter?
1 m³ is equal to 4,227 cup. To convert Cubic Meter back to US Cup, multiply the cubic meter value by 4,227.
